Canada Imports
In Canada, consumer goods accounted for 20% of total imports in 2018, followed by motor vehicles and parts (19%), electronic and electrical equipment and parts (12%), industrial machinery, equipment, and parts (11%), basic and industrial chemical, plastic, and rubber products (8%), metal and non-metallic mineral products (7%), and energy products (6%). Canada's largest trading partners were the United States (which accounted for 64% of total imports), the European Union (10%), with Germany accounting for 3%, China (8%), Mexico (3%), and Japan (2%).
A higher than expected figure should be seen as positive (bullish) for the CAD while a lower than expected figure should be seen as negative (bearish) for the CAD.
